Official: A joint resolution providing for congressional disapproval under chapter 8 of title 5, United States Code, of the rule submitted by the Department of Education relating to "William D. Ford Federal Direct Loan (Direct Loan) Program".
This resolution nullifies a rule that prevents federal loan forgiveness for employees of organizations involved in illegal activities.
1. This resolution removes protections that prevent loan forgiveness for employees of organizations involved in illegal activities. 2. It allows borrowers to receive Public Service Loan Forgiveness benefits even if their employers engage in substantial illegal actions. 3. The resolution eliminates the accountability measures that ensure taxpayer money is not misused in the loan forgiveness program. 4. By disapproving this rule, Congress opens the door for organizations with illegal purposes to benefit from taxpayer-funded loan forgiveness.
This resolution affects borrowers working for organizations that may engage in illegal activities, as well as taxpayers funding the loan program.
